15 Beautiful Mosques of Sri Lanka
Here are some of the best examples of Muslim architecture in Sri Lanka. Architecturally brilliant and historically important, these stunning mosques exude the diversity of the local Muslims. How many are you familiar with?
These ornate places of worship are held in high regard by the locals and serve as places of awe and magnificence towards visitors. Many of these mosques have elaborate domes, minarets and prayer halls. Mosque designs in Sri Lanka has been influenced by Islamic architecture from around the world including Indian, Turkish, Egyptian, Arabian and Iranian. They serve as a place where Muslims can come together for their daily 5 times prayers (salat) as well as a center for information, education, and socialising.
Red Mosque – Colombo 11
1908 Old Mosque Section, Second Cross Street
Image Credit: Dan Lundberg
2015 New Mosque Section, Main Street
Image Credit: M. Barends
Official Name: Jami Ul-Alfar Masjid
Other Names: Samman Kottu Palli, ‘Rathu Palliya’, ‘Red Masjid’
Address: No.228, Second Cross Street, Colombo 11, Sri Lanka.
Location:: Google Map
Founded: ?
Old Mosque Facade: 1908
New Mosque Facade: 2015
Architecture Style: Indo-Saracenic
Capacity: Current 10,000 (1,500 Original)

Galle Fort Mosque
Image Credit: Dan Lundberg
Official Name: Meeran Masjid
Address: Rampart Street, Galle Fort, Galle, Sri Lanka.
Location:: Google Map
Founded: 300+ History
Current Facade: 1904
Architecture Style: Baroque Architecture (Portuguese Cathedral Style)
